我在一个页面中有一个简单的<a>
,它使用FrameWork7
,如下所示:
<li><a href="https://www.google.com/"><img src="images/icons/black/users.png" alt="" title="" /><span>Go Google/span></a></li>
但是当我点击它时,它并不是重定向到google页面。我检查了控制台,它显示如下:
XMLHttpRequest cannot load https://www.google.com/. No 'Access-Control-Allow-Origin' header is present on the requested resource. Origin 'http://localhost:8080' is therefore not allowed access.
framework7.js:12307 XHR failed loading: GET "https://www.google.com/".$.ajax @ framework7.js:12307app.get @ framework7.js:1652app.router.load @ framework7.js:2648load @ framework7.js:636handleClicks @ framework7.js:7573handleLiveEvent @ framework7.js:11488
我是Framework7
的新手。我购买了一个开发模板。
发布于 2016-08-25 17:25:36
正如文档所说:
可以绕过F7链接处理程序(如果您想要添加自定义逻辑链接,或者希望它直接到外部网站)。在这种情况下,我们需要额外的
external
类
<a class="link external" href="http://google.com">Open Google</a>
您希望链接到Framework7应用程序的外部,所以只需将external
类添加到a href
中并使其正常工作。
<li><a href="https://www.google.com/" class="external"><img src="images/icons/black/users.png" alt="" title="" /><span>Go Google</span></a></li>
并看到您在打印结束的span标记。
发布于 2016-08-23 23:21:53
您没有关闭span,还添加了一个目标:
<li><a href="https://www.google.com/" target="_blank"><img src="images/icons/black/users.png" alt="" title="" /><span>Go Google</span></a></li>
https://stackoverflow.com/questions/39116798
复制